Description (TAIR10)
unknown protein; FUNCTIONS IN: molecular_function unknown; INVOLVED IN: biological_process unknown; LOCATED IN: endomembrane system; CONTAINS InterPro DOMAIN/s: Protein of unknown function DUF239, plant (InterPro:IPR004314); BEST Arabidopsis thaliana protein match is: unknown protein (TAIR:AT4G23360.1); Has 2365 Blast hits to 710 proteins in 27 species: Archae - 0; Bacteria - 35; Metazoa - 0; Fungi - 30; Plants - 2300; Viruses - 0; Other Eukaryotes - 0 (source: NCBI BLink).
